Description of problem: Banshee's "Now Playing" page has a fullscreen mode. Selecting this causes the workspaces to go black, while the cursor remains visible.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): 1.9.5 How reproducible: Every time Steps to Reproduce: 1. Start banshee and begin playing a music track 2. Select "Now Playing" from the left-hand library pane 3. Click on the "Fullscreen" button in the upper right Actual results: Screen turns black. The cursor is visible. Switching workspaces, you see app windows and background during transition, but all workspaces are black after transition. Activities overlay works properly, but banshee cannot be closed using the button on the overlay thumbnail. Alt+F2 dialog works properly, running "killall banshee-1" kills banshee, and workspaces are properly visible again. Expected results: The Now Playing page should expand to full screen, displaying album art and track info. Cursor movement should reveal "Exit Fullscreen" button. Additional info:
